This might not be a tech problem.

 

 

 

Some keyboards have these little keys working on sort of suction cups and sometimes they get stuck. Try pressing and wiggling. If that doesn't work, try pressing quite hard, and releasing slowly, if that still doesn't work, try releasing quickly. And if all of those don't work, it IS a tech problem. lol
